Norbury Office Closure — Managers Only

Status: approved. The Norbury satellite office of Caldix Partners closes at quarter-end. Seven staff move to remote contracts; lease surrender negotiated with minimal penalty. Finance to book closure costs this period and reclaim equipment by the 15th. Keep this off general channels until staff are notified. Background for the decision follows.

board note of bajop-yaweg: The western region missed its Pelys quota by 58.0 percent last quarter. Pelysek Foods plans to raise the Belius list price by 44.0 percent in July. The steering committee signed off on a budget of $133.8 million for Project Pelax. The renewal with Zoraelix Systems closes at $61.9 million a year, 12.7 percent above the last contract.

Installation of the Lumastock sensors completed in eight locations; the remaining four follow next month. Branch managers should ensure staff route all Brennick inquiries to the pilot coordination team and avoid discussing terms with store personnel. Weekly data reviews occur every Tuesday. Early read: stockout detection accuracy exceeds targets. The strategic context for this pilot is summarized in the note below.

board note of baweg-bawig: Project Tamath slips by six weeks because of the audit delay.

- [ ] **GC pause check — Matchbox pairing service.** Before you sign off, run the soak test and make sure p99 pause stays under 40ms; the new heap settings should handle it, but last cycle we got burned. If it's over, ping the runtime folks and hold the train. Record results against the build token below.

pipeline stamp: htk9_ce63042d9

# Break-Glass: Catalog Cache Invalidation

Scope: the Pinrow product catalog at Veldstone Retail. If stale prices persist after a purge and the Hollowmere invalidation queue is wedged, use break-glass to flush the edge tier directly. Contractors: get verbal sign-off from the catalog lead first. Steps: open the Hollowmere admin shell, select emergency-flush, confirm the tenant, and run it once — repeated flushes thrash the origin. Access is logged and expires after 20 minutes. Unseal the admin shell with the passphrase below.

recovery phrase for kahop-tajog: istix-casvan